Educated Mess Sake Bomb Ingredients
- Sake Ferment – This is a byproduct of sake fermentation and is rich in essential vitamins, amino acids, enzymes and peptides that will support the skin barrier. Sake ferment has been used in Japanese beauty for years after sake brewers noticed their hands were virtually ageless after years of brewing sake.
- Encapsulated Peptides – The peptides used in this moisturizer are designed to promote hyaluronic acid production which helps to plump the skin. The unique delivery system for these targeted peptides allows them to penetrate further into the skin. Rather than sitting on the surface or being broken down before they can provide benefits.
- Marine Bioferment – This is a hydrating active ingredient derived through the fermentation of a bacteria strain specifically known for its unique properties. This bioferment was found to boost the skin’s natural moisturizing factors. It helps reduce water loss and leave the skin with a healthy glow.
